Output 6dac5c7ab2ab70ef4d1603792fc19be889f12dc895491476079789cc8e59ec65:2

value
3367161514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0a1af6a11a0b3b0941583fe4b4c23518c7be36 OP_EQUAL
address
MDTuZGAFU7avPEvdwyjyP6CavzJ2PH1v2d
transaction
6dac5c7ab2ab70ef4d1603792fc19be889f12dc895491476079789cc8e59ec65
spent
true